Lucid Diagnostics Inc. (NASDAQ:LUCD) is a commercial-stage medical-diagnostics firm that markets the EsoGuard Esophageal DNA Test, which is performed on cells collected via the EsoCheck device. The test targets GERD patients at elevated risk for esophageal adenocarcinoma (EAC), aiming to detect precancerous changes early enough to reduce mortality. Lucid operates as a subsidiary of PAVmed and is headquartered in New York.

LUCD`s Overall Dividend Rating is (unknown). Ratings surpassing 65% are regarded as acceptable, exceeding 75% are favorable and surpassing 85% are strong.Key Metric Definitions
- Dividend Yield
- Annual dividend per share divided by current share price.
- Payout Ratio
- Percentage of earnings paid as dividends. Below 60% = safe, above 100% = unsustainable.
- Payout FCF
- Percentage of Free Cash Flow paid as dividends. More reliable than Payout Ratio since it measures actual cash.
- Growth Rate (CAGR)
- Compound annual growth rate of dividends over the last 5 years.
- Consistency
- Reliability of dividend payments over lifetime. Penalizes cuts and pauses.
- Yield on Cost
- Your effective yield if you bought 5 years ago. Shows dividend growth impact over time.
- Streak
- Consecutive years of dividend payments. 25+ years = Dividend Aristocrat.
- Dividend Rating
- Proprietary score (0-100) combining yield, growth, safety and consistency.
